The most commonly used kinds of concealed hinges are o26, o35 and o40. The o26 hinge is smaller hinge commonly used on domestic furniture. The o35 hinge is the most common cup hinge, and is used on larger furniture like kitchens. The hinge o40 is the most durable of the three sizes and is ideal for use in heavy-duty applications.

Sash weights

Counterweights, such as sash weights are used together with pulleys or cables that counterbalance the weight of windows to ensure they can open and shut smoothly without slamming. Blacksmiths will not be too concerned about them since they're cast iron and can't be manufactured. They can be purchased at scrap yards for as low as $0.10 per pound.

Selecting the correct sash weight for windows requires precision and careful attention to detail. Accurate measurements are crucial because a lapse in measurement could result in the window not being properly balanced or can't be opened. There are a variety of ways to avoid the problem, including using the digital scale or tape measure that's calibrated.

It is crucial to consider the height and width of the window when installing the sashweight. A tall, wide window will require a larger counterweight compared to a shorter and smaller window. The sashweight needs to be properly placed within the weight pocket. The pocket for weights should be sized and located so that the sash is able to move through it without hitting the counterweight or getting stuck.

Regular maintenance of sash weight systems will help prevent issues, such as frayed cords and misaligned pulleys. It is also recommended that sash weight systems be checked at least once per year to spot any issues before they become serious. By regularly securing sash weight systems, homeowners can enjoy years of smooth operation and energy efficiency.

Installation

Window hinges play an essential function in allowing windows to open and close correctly. They also affect the window's structural integrity, airflow and energy efficiency. Therefore, it's important to identify and repair hinge issues before they become more severe. This will increase the life span of your windows and also make them more energy efficient.

When installing new hinges, it's important to follow the manufacturer's guidelines. This will ensure a proper installation of new hinges and smooth operation of the window. Incorrect installation can lead to gaps between the window frame and sash which can cause drafts or energy loss. Incorrectly aligned hinges or fastened hinges can make it difficult to open and shut the window sash.

The right hinge for casement windows is essential. There are many different hinge types that each have their own specifications and specifications. If you choose the wrong hinge, it could result in problems, including difficulties opening and closing the window sash, inefficient ventilation, and safety hazards. The handle position is a simple way to identify the correct hinge type. Hinges with the handle fixed at the bottom are called side-hung hinges, while hinges with the handle at the top are called top-hung hinges.
